I can't say much in the form of Yoshi specific stuff but #1 rule when fighting a Luigi: Whenever Luigi is getting combo'd, they will always, always, always n-air/ d-air out of it. Usually n-air because it comes out faster and will trade with many attacks, even outprioritize them.

So what you wanna do is space yourself accordingly. When you combo a Luigi, combo from the sides and be wary of n-air. Either that or bait it out because literally 90% of the time, Luigis will try to n-air out of a combo.

Honestly, that side b is killing you. If you need to reposition, try using a combination of wavelands and dashdancing. F-tilts are your friend, and understand that it's not always a good idea to egg spam from ledge vs some characters. All around, you make really good use of your spacing, but you don't really have a solid approach. Double jump cancelled attacks are always fun, but even try changing your attacks up by doing a dashgrab. I myself picked up yoshi, and the unique thing about him is how he can travel through the air. And use that d-air more. It has really high damage potential and can usually be followed up with a jab reset into grab or an up tilt/f-tilt. Either way, just keep playing. You'll get there man.
